Pendant Dimensions

Specification Size
Width 8.04 mm
Side Depth 3.99 mm
Total Height with Pearl 27.88 mm

The narrow width and elongated profile create a lightweight visual structure with strong vertical movement across the neckline.


Diamond Configuration

Stone Type Size Quantity
Round Diamond RD 1.0 mm 9
Round Diamond RD 1.1 mm 15
Round Diamond RD 1.2 mm 8

Total Stone Count

  • 32 round diamonds
  • Approximate total diamond weight: 0.159 CT

Production Notes

This pendant uses visual restraint strategically. Instead of fully covering the structure with pavé diamonds, the polished spiral connector introduces negative space that increases contrast and improves overall dimensional clarity.

The vertical arrangement also distributes visual weight progressively from top to bottom, guiding focus naturally toward the suspended pearl centerpiece.
